Adam Zagoria tweeted that IU has reached out to Joe Girard from Syracuse. I’ll add him to the list in my original post. 

“During his four seasons with the Orange, JGIII was best known for his 3-point shooting, knocking down over 40% in his junior year and 38% as a senior. However, his subpar defense and tendency to play “hero ball” made him a polarizing figure among the Syracuse fanbase.”

I know we are looking at the guy from Harvard, but there are a couple of Princeton guys I would really consider as well 

Evbuomwan is a senior and the Ivy League doesn’t allow a fifth year, so if he wants to continue playing college ball……..
